Hunt Spain

Spain has 12 species of big game and is one of the top hunting destinations in the world. Game populations are at an all-time high due to excellent management and the changes in rural agriculture practices over time. It is also one of the top destinations for cultural tourism with amazing heritage sites and boasts some of the top wines and cuisine in the world. Whether you are looking to achieve the Spanish grand slam of the four ibex species, experiencing an action-packed monteria (driven hunt) or looking for something slower-paced, Spain is a 'must do' for the travelling sportsman. Species available as follows: Gredos ibex, Ronda ibex, Beceite ibex, Southeast ibex, Pyrenees chamois, Cantabrian chamois, roe deer, red deer, fallow deer, mouflon, Barbary sheep and wild boar. 

Hunt Hungary / Czechia / Slovakia

Hungary has a deep cultural tradition of hunting. It has an excellent reputation for large trophies and yet remains reasonably priced. The capital city of Budapest is currently enjoying a surge in tourist attention for good reason - excellent history and sights, a vibrant nightlife and reasonable prices. River cruises on the Danube are extremely popular now as well. Species available include: fallow deer, red deer, wild boar and roe deer. Hungary is also renowned for its top-notch bird hunting.  

Hunt Slovenia

Slovenia is a hidden gem that will not remain unnoticed by the international tourist community for long. It has the incredible mountains of the Julian alps, beautiful limestone rivers, lush farmland and a slice of the Adriatic Sea. I predict Lake Bled as being the future 'Instagram' capital of the world and is a must see! Slovenia has a very popular fly-fishing industry as well and prices are extremely reasonable. Hunting is deeply-rooted in their culture and they have excellent hunting opportunities for Alpine chamois, red deer, roe deer, fallow deer and wild boar. A few alpine ibex tags are released each year as well. Prices remain reasonable but I do not believe that will last long so this is a destination to consider in the near future for the travelling sportsman.  

Hunt England

Often overlooked as a hunting destination, England is an excellent choice for those looking to explore London and other amazing places and still get some hunting in for a few days. They have somewhat-unique species such as muntjac and Chinese water deer but also offer excellent hunting for fallow deer, red deer and roe deer. Some excellent hunting opportunities exist within 2 hours drive of London which lends itself well to a combined cultural tourism / hunting holiday.
